Allows a dispatcher or radio-caller to notify a targeted radio-user (or group of radio-users) of a missed call; also known as a Page. Receiving radios are targeted based on Radio IDs. Radio IDs can be defined for use in the Radio's Call Hot Lists or entered directly by the radio-user. The receiving radio responds with an alert-tone, and shows evidence of a missed call through the intelligent lighting feature and / or lighting the radio's call light. The visual alert persists until reset by the returning radio-user with any button-press.

For Conventional Personalities, the Non-ASTRO Call Page's Call Alert Rx / Tx field and the ASTRO Call Page's Call Alert Rx / Tx field configure Conventional Call Alert capabilities. |
|
For Trunking Personalities, the Call / Page Page's Call Alert / Page Operation field configures Trunking Call Alert capabilities |
